Yes, Riverside County is larger than Orange County. Riverside County covers an area of approximately 7,303 square miles, making it one of the largest counties in California. In contrast, Orange County has an area of about 948 square miles. This significant difference in size highlights Riverside County's expansive geography compared to its neighbor.
